Cup of Gold
John Steinbeck
Read by Kurt
Steinbeck's first novel, a historical fiction account of Henry (Captain) Morgan. The title comes from his sacking of Panama City which was entitled "The Cup of Gold" in the era. - Summary by Kurt Papke (8 hr 10 min)
